Chraberce is a municipality and village in Louny District in the Ústí nad Labem Region of the Czech Republic. It has about 100 inhabitants.
Chraberce lies approximately 7 kilometres (4 mi) north of Louny, 32 km (20 mi) south-west of Ústí nad Labem, and 56 km (35 mi) north-west of Prague.
